Comprehensive Guide to Retail Shelving Types

Retail stores utilize various shelving systems, each designed for specific product categories and spatial requirements. Below we examine these essential retail components:

1. The Classic Choice: Gondola Shelving

Gondola shelving remains the backbone of retail displays, particularly in supermarkets and convenience stores, prized for its functionality and adaptability.

Key Features:

  • Freestanding structure that doesn't require wall support, allowing flexible placement
  • Available in single-sided (wall-mounted) and double-sided (aisle) configurations
  • Adjustable shelves accommodate products of varying heights
  • High weight capacity suitable for diverse merchandise

Ideal Applications:

  • Universal suitability for nearly all product categories from groceries to household items
  • Perfect for creating supermarket aisles or central display areas in convenience stores

The versatility and stability of gondola shelving make it effective across various retail environments and product display needs.

2. Space Optimization Expert: Wall Shelving

As the name suggests, wall shelving consists of single-sided units mounted directly to walls, making them ideal for vertical space utilization while maintaining clear walkways.

Common Uses:

  • Pharmacies: For medications and health supplements
  • Grocery stores: Displaying canned goods and condiments
  • Beauty retailers: Showcasing skincare and cosmetics
  • Home goods stores: Presenting cleaning supplies and small appliances

Wall shelving efficiently utilizes vertical space while maintaining a clean, organized store appearance that facilitates customer browsing.

3. Promotional Powerhouse: End Cap Shelving

Positioned at the ends of gondola units, end cap shelving serves as a strategic tool for capturing customer attention and driving sales.

Primary Functions:

  • Highlighting promotional items and new product launches
  • Displaying seasonal merchandise like holiday gifts or summer beverages
  • Showcasing high-margin products
  • Featuring impulse purchase items such as snacks or small accessories

The prominent placement of end caps significantly increases product visibility and sales potential.

4. Lightweight and Ventilated: Wire Shelving

Constructed from metal mesh, wire shelving offers durability combined with excellent airflow, making it particularly suitable for certain product categories.

Typical Applications:

  • Produce sections for fruits and vegetables
  • Snack aisles for chips and crackers
  • Clearance areas for discounted merchandise
  • Bakery displays for breads and pastries

The open design of wire shelving enhances product visibility while promoting air circulation that helps maintain freshness.

5. Premium Presentation: Wooden or Specialty Display Shelves

Crafted from wood or decorative materials, these shelving units elevate store aesthetics and brand presentation.

Common Implementations:

  • Bookstores for hardcover editions and stationery
  • Electronics retailers for premium devices and accessories
  • Boutiques for apparel and fashion items
  • Gift shops for specialty souvenirs

These shelves prioritize visual appeal and brand image over heavy-duty functionality, creating more inviting shopping environments.

6. Flexible Display Solution: Pegboard & Slatwall Systems

Consisting of vertical panels with interchangeable hooks, shelves, and brackets, these systems offer exceptional adaptability for diverse merchandise.

Ideal For:

  • Hardware stores displaying tools and parts
  • Beauty retailers showcasing brushes and hair accessories
  • Small packaged goods like keychains and phone cases
  • Hanging items including clothing and jewelry

The reconfigurable nature of these systems allows quick adaptation to changing product displays and merchandising needs.

Selecting the Right Shelving for Your Store
  • Store Type: Supermarkets need heavy-duty gondolas while boutiques prioritize visual presentation
  • Product Characteristics: Dense items require sturdy steel shelving while lightweight accessories suit pegboard systems
  • Space Configuration: Narrow spaces benefit from wall shelving while open areas accommodate double-sided gondolas
  • Visibility Requirements: Perishables need the airflow of wire shelving
  • Durability Needs: High-traffic stores require robust steel construction
Shelving Materials: Understanding the Options
  • Steel: The most common choice for durability and weight capacity, ideal for gondola and wall shelving
  • Wire Mesh: Lightweight and ventilated, perfect for produce and bakery sections
  • Wood/MDF: Aesthetic appeal for premium retail environments

Expert Recommendations by Store Type

Industry best practices suggest these shelving approaches for different retail formats:

Supermarkets:

  • Aisles: Double-sided gondolas
  • Perimeter: Single-sided gondolas
  • Promotional areas: End caps
  • Produce sections: Wire shelving

Convenience Stores:

  • Slim-profile gondolas
  • Wall shelving for snacks and beverages
  • Hook systems near checkout for impulse items

Pharmacies:

  • High-visibility gondolas
  • Lightweight wall shelving
  • Clearly labeled, organized layouts
